Specifications
Complete list of technical specificationsGraphics processing unit (GPU)
Contrast the GPU cores between MSI GeForce GTX 960 Gaming LE 100ME and ZOTAC GeForce GTX 960 2xDVI graphics cards. The GPU core details encompass the quantity of blocks (referred to as Shader Engine (SE) in AMD documentation and Graphics Processing Clusters (GPC) in Nvidia documentation) as well as ROP/TMUs (Raster Processing Units). These specifications significantly impact the computational prowess of the GPU.
| Specification | Value | 
|---|---|
| Based on | NVIDIA GeForce GTX 960  NVIDIA GeForce GTX 960 | 
| GPU Chip | GM206-300-A1 (Maxwell 2.0)  GM206-300-A1 (Maxwell 2.0) | 
| Execution units | 8  8 | 
| Shader | 1024  1024 | 
| Render Output Units | 32  32 | 
| Texture Units | 64  64 | 
Memory
Compare the quantity, type, and speed of memory, as well as the bandwidth, in MSI GeForce GTX 960 Gaming LE 100ME and ZOTAC GeForce GTX 960 2xDVI GPUs. Ample graphics memory, high frequency, and sufficient bandwidth contribute positively to high-resolution texture processing speed.
| Specification | Value | 
|---|---|
| Memory Size | 2 GB  2 GB | 
| Memory Type | GDDR5  GDDR5 | 
| Memory Clock | 1.753 GHz  1.753 GHz | 
| Memory Speed | 7.01 Gbps  7.01 Gbps | 
| Memory Bandwith | 112 GB/s  112 GB/s | 
| Memory Interface | 128 bit  128 bit |

Cooler & Fans
In this section, we'll examine the cooling solutions for MSI GeForce GTX 960 Gaming LE 100ME and ZOTAC GeForce GTX 960 2xDVI, along with their dimensions and effectiveness. Typically, fans with larger diameters hold an advantage as they can move equivalent air volumes at lower speeds compared to smaller fans. It's worth noting that liquid cooling systems, in addition to fans and aluminum radiators, require a pump, which may contribute to noise levels.
| Specification | Value | 
|---|---|
| Fan-Type | Axial  Axial | 
| Fan 1 | 2 x 100 mm  2 x 75 mm | 
| Cooler-Type | Air cooling  Air cooling | 
| Noise (Idle) | 0 dB / Silent  0 dB / Silent |

Dimensions
Explore the dimensions comparison of the MSI GeForce GTX 960 Gaming LE 100ME and ZOTAC GeForce GTX 960 2xDVI graphics cards. Having precise measurements enables you to determine compatibility with your PC case. Additionally, we've incorporated support for the PCI Express bus.
| Specification | Value | 
|---|---|
| Length | 267 mm  206 mm | 
| Height | 139 mm  111 mm | 
| Width | 48 mm  -- | 
| Width (Slots) | 3 PCIe-Slots  2 PCIe-Slots | 
| Weight | 860 g  -- |
